I was born in Samedan and made my apprentice ship as an electrician in my hometown. The airport was a military and private one. In winter (1960 Temp -36 C) they rebuild the airport and I was part of the construction help in the electrical of the tower and main building.

I would love to see that little airport in your collection. If you try to fly from LOWI to LSZS it is quite a nice experience.

There is no ILS and I remember the Greek oil tycoon landed in Samedan with his B737 when it was quite a low ceiling of fog. He started in Zernez east from Samedan and flew along the river Inn to the airport.

I'm biased since it's my home state, but North Carolina is indeed a nice place that would make an excellent Orbx region. North Carolina has the highest mountains in the Eastern United States; the Piedmont region with its many cities, towns, hills, forests, and fields; the flat farmland of the Inner Coastal Plain; and a varied coastline with beaches, sounds, and the Outer Banks, where the Wright brothers made their first powered flight. With such beautiful and varied scenery and an important place in aviation history, I think North Carolina would be a great candidate for an Orbx region.
